Bankroll Management
Bankroll management is the single most important skill in sports betting — more important than tips, systems, or prediction tools. Here's a simple, practical framework used by disciplined bettors across Malaysia.
Decide how much money you're comfortable allocating to sports betting. This should be money you can afford to lose entirely without it affecting your life. Top it up only at the start of each month — never mid-month to chase losses.
A "unit" is your standard bet size. Most professional bettors recommend 1–3% of your total bankroll per bet. On a MYR 1,000 bankroll, that's MYR 10–30 per bet. This protects you from variance wiping out your stake too quickly.
You may bet 2 units on a match you feel strongly about and 1 unit on a more speculative pick. Never go more than 3–5 units on a single bet regardless of how confident you feel. Confidence is not certainty.
Judge your performance over monthly cycles, not individual days. Short-term variance can make a great bettor look terrible for two weeks. Evaluate your ROI (Return on Investment) over 50–100 bets minimum before drawing conclusions.

Reading Odds
Odds tell you two things: how likely the bookmaker thinks an outcome is, and how much you'll win. At eg33, odds are displayed in decimal format (the standard in Malaysia and across Asia). Here's how to read them and calculate potential returns.
Your return = Stake × Odds. Profit = (Stake × Odds) − Stake.
| Odds | MYR 50 Stake Returns | Implied Probability |
|---|---|---|
| 1.50 | MYR 75 (profit MYR 25) | 66.7% |
| 2.00 | MYR 100 (profit MYR 50) | 50.0% |
| 3.00 | MYR 150 (profit MYR 100) | 33.3% |
| 5.00 | MYR 250 (profit MYR 200) | 20.0% |

Glossary
New to sports betting at eg33? Here's a quick reference for the most common terms you'll encounter in our sportsbook.
A handicap system that eliminates the draw by giving a goal advantage or disadvantage to each team. -0.5 means the team must win outright; +0.5 means a draw is good enough for your bet to win.
A bet on total combined goals, points, or rounds. "Over 2.5 goals" wins if three or more goals are scored. Very popular for football and basketball on eg33.
Combining multiple selections into one bet where all must win for the bet to pay out. Each win multiplies the odds, producing larger potential returns — but also compounding the risk.
A bet that results in neither a win nor a loss — your stake is returned. Common on exact handicap lines (e.g., -1 AH when the team wins by exactly one goal).
The bookmaker's built-in commission on every market. On a coin-flip, true odds would be 2.00/2.00. With vig, you'll see 1.90/1.90. Understanding the margin helps you find better-value markets.
"Sharp" bettors are professionals who move lines with large, informed wagers. "Squares" are recreational bettors who bet on popular teams emotionally. Following sharp money is a recognised strategy.
When the odds for a market change between opening and kick-off. Movement toward a team indicates sharp or heavy public money coming in. Tracking line movement at eg33 can signal where the value lies.
If you bet a team at 2.20 and the market closes at 1.85, you beat the closing line — a strong indicator that you made a good bet, regardless of the outcome.
